#090463 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#090463 is composed of 3.5% red, 1.6%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 96%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 243.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 20.2%. #090463 color hex could be obtained by blending #1208c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#090463

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000005 is the darkest color, while #f2f1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#090463

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#303037 is the less saturated color, while #050067 is the most saturated one.
